Situation:

Situation: Even though Monroe County is basically a rural county, most of the residents do not live on a farm that provides a major part of the family’s income. There is renewed interest in producing our food locally. There is an interest in providing the Master Gardener program again in Monroe County. Since most residents don’t live on farms, the art of gardening has been lost by many. With one year completed of community gardens, there is great interest in expanding Monroe County’s Community Gardens; both in size and new locations.
